Pros

Ability to move up the ranks quick. Exposure to various, techincal accounting topics. Open door policy with upper management.

Cons

High turnover meaning high workload on remaining staff. Extended busy season that bleeds into May/June. Management style doesn't always provide the opportunity to teach. Compensation and performance reviews are not transparent.

Pros

Compensation is OK. There are some really nice people in the organization to work with, but you have to find them.

Cons

If you are not part of the SWC "club" (company name prior to them joining BDO), good luck. Poor leadership!!! Practice lead talks to everyone like they are talking to a CEO, not relatable in most cases. No clear employee development plans. You are held accountable for things completely outside of your individual control. They stress incorporating AI into work strategy, but have no plan on what that looks like or how to do it and want everyone to formulate it because leadership has no roadmap. One has no control over where you want to take your career, yet you are expected to know everything, about everything. As a result, you become an expert of nothing! Work assigned rarely leverages skills, almost as if they throw darts to see who works on what.
